摘要
Green manufacturing in the semiconductor industry with a comprehensive commitment to environmentally benign practices across the spectrum of the manufacturing process to sustain the industry in the 21st century is discussed. It will involve incorporating environmental awareness from green manufacturing and green fabs to eco-friendly processing and manufacturing waste recycling. Green manufacturing begins with adopting environmentally preferable purchasing (EPP) that favors products manufactured, packaged, and distributed with superior environmental, safety, and health (ESH) characteristics. An integrated system of specially engineered tools, methods, products, and supporting technologies that collectively reduce energy and resource consumption constitute the green fab benefitting a company's bottom line. Green processing involves a wide-spread, quality-oriented methodology for assessing the environmental effects of new materials, while recycling and reuse ensure resource management.
